Beieinander Translations, meanings and synonyms

"Beieinander" is mainly used as adverb meaning "together", "near each other" or "close by". It is also used as adjective.

Meanings of "beieinander" + more translations, synonyms and antonyms

It has the meanings and uses detailed below:

1.) "Close together, near each other"

"Beieinander", when used with this meaning, acts as adverb.

📝 Some usage examples:
  1. Die Kinder spielen beieinander im Garten.The children are playing together in the garden.
  2. Wir sitzen beieinander und reden über alte Zeiten.We sit together and talk about old times.
  3. Die Bücher stehen beieinander im Regal.The books are standing close together on the shelf.

2.) "Mentally composed, in control"

"Beieinander", when used with this meaning, acts as adjective.

📝 Some usage examples:
  1. Nach dem Schock war sie nicht mehr ganz beieinander.After the shock, she was not entirely composed anymore.
  2. Er ist immer beieinander, egal was passiert.He is always composed, no matter what happens.
  3. Sie war nach der Nachricht völlig beieinander.She was completely composed after the news.
